Output 84ec3030c84d2f5b762feeaa3b729baf771114ea7dc07ac052d0bca67b0c7839:1

value
1208000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a2be9c7909986d668155e031dc1e2d6b56014ca OP_EQUAL
address
3EHbnABNgioeuTApLSnPvPL7GNfmj8YQYB
transaction
84ec3030c84d2f5b762feeaa3b729baf771114ea7dc07ac052d0bca67b0c7839
confirmations
367351
spent
true